Biography
- Michel Litvak derives his fortune from OTEKO, a Moscow-based investor with interests in port and industrial infrastructure in southern Russia.
- He started out trading consumer goods between Russia and China in 1991, following the collapse of the Soviet Union.
- In 1992 he entered the oil railroad business and founded OTEKO, then a major railroad operator.
- In 2018 Litvak sold the railroad business, and has focused on expanding his port and infrastructure companies.
- Through his business Litvak owns two seaport terminals on the Black Sea coast: LPG Transshipment Complex and Taman Bulk Cargo Terminal.
- Born in Leningrad, Litvak's parents were Russian Jews. In the 1960s his family left the Soviet Union and immigrated to Belgium; he now holds dual citizenship in Russia and Belgium.
- Litvak has produced films, including Whiplash, Drive, Nightcrawler and Shot Caller.
- Litvak was granted Russian citizenship in 2019.
